I'm passing the appointment reminder cron to Petra before I rotate off. The job runs nightly, pulls tomorrow's bookings from the Larkspur scheduler, and dispatches SMS and email batches through the Quillgate relay. Known quirk: the retry queue occasionally double-sends if the relay times out mid-batch; the dedupe window mostly covers it. Dashboards are under the "reminders-prod" folder. For the weekly sync, the only action item is confirming the dedupe window size. The current production configuration is as follows.

config for kafof-bawef:
holath:
  log_level: debug
  metrics_host: metrics.holath.qorvelsys.internal
  pin: 2191
  pool_size: 32

## Runbook: Harrowfield telemetry gateway restarts

When reviewing changes to the gateway, verify that the reconnect loop preserves the last-known offset per tractor unit; dropping it causes duplicate soil-sensor batches downstream in Siloflow. A safe restart drains the MQTT buffer, flushes to the staging topic, then re-registers with the internal Fieldgate provisioning service. Registration fails silently without a valid credential, so confirm the review environment uses the key directly below.

gateway credential: kto3_qfe

Markdown pipeline runbook — Ferngate renderer. If preview output is blank, check the Slateroot sanitizer stage first; it silently drops documents over 2MB. Restart the worker pool, then replay the failed queue from the Mirrowell dashboard. Do not clear the cache unless rendering errors persist after replay. Escalate to the Ferngate on-call if replay loops twice. Verification requires the trace token from the last successful replay, shown below.

trace token, yahif-kagep: htk31_bd0cc6b1d7ab4f7094c586a5de900e0